A West German television report from 1987 shows scenes from everyday life in the capital of the GDR. In Berlin-Friedrichshagen, we see a butcher's shop, a hat salon, the volunteer fire department and the lively Friedrichshagen open-air swimming pool.
A queue forms in front of the Krause butcher's shop. "A familiar picture from the GDR. A signal that shopping could be worthwhile," announces the voiceover. There is no shortage of goods here. The sales assistants serve the many customers in a friendly manner and offer them a large selection of meat and sausage products.
The hat salon in Bölschestraße is very popular with customers from all over the city. Hats are all the rage at the moment and business is booming. The Hutsalon is a meeting place for fashion-conscious women who follow the latest trends and like to treat themselves.
A tracking shot across what was then Bölschestraße brings us to the next feature on the volunteer fire department. A burning vehicle is quickly extinguished in a fire drill. "We extinguish every fire" is the slogan of the volunteer fire department, which has now been in existence for over 100 years.
There is also a lot going on at the Friedrichshagen outdoor pool. The swimming supervisor there is not to be trifled with. He keeps a strict eye on order on the premises and the discipline of the bathers who bravely jump into the water from the 5-meter diving tower.
